iOS Training by Experts

;

Our Training Process

iOS - Syllabus, Fees & Duration

  • iOS Development Environment

    • Introduction to iOS SDK
    • What’s new in iOS9
    • SDK Tools
      • What’s new in Xcode7
      • Using XCode
      • Using Interface Builder
      • Using iPhone Simulator
  • Swift Language Basics

    • Core Data Types
    • String Type
    • Tuples & Optional
    • Constants & Variables
    • Statements & Operators
    • Control Flow & Decisions
    • Functions
  • Basic Object Oriented Programming using Swift

    • Structs
    • Types versus instances
    • Member and static methods
    • Custom initialization & De-initialization
    • Classes
    • Initialization
    • Methods
    • Properties
  • Advanced Object Oriented Programming using Swift

    • Optional
      • Introducing optional
      • Unwrapping an optional
      • Optional binding
    • Nested Types
    • Generic Types
    • Protocol
  • Memory Management

    • Reference Counting Basics
    • Automatic Reference Count
    • Retain Cycles
  • iPhone Application Basics

    • Anatomy of an iPhone application
    • Application Lifecycle and States
  • User Interface Programming– Basics

    • UI Kit Framework
    • XIB and Interface Builder
    • Window & View
    • Basic User Controls
      • Labels, Text Fields, Buttons, Sliders, Picker etc.
      • Building application screens
      • Alerts and Action Sheets
  • Auto-layout and Constraints

  • View Controllers

    • Basics
    • Creating View Controllers
    • Content vs Container View Controllers
    • Orientation Management
  • User Interface– Special Views

    • Image View
    • Scroll View
    • Table Views
      • Populating and configuring Table View
      • Data Source and Delegate
      • Table View Cells
      • Custom Cells
      • Editing Table View
    • Collection View
  • Multiple View Controllers

    • Applications with Multiple Views
    • Presenting View Controllers
    • Animating View Switching
  • Storyboards

    • Storyboard File
    • View Controller and Scene
    • Segue
    • Invoking a Segue
    • XIB and Storyboards
    • Table View Cell Prototype
  • Multi Touch and Gestures API

  • Data Persistence - 1

    • File System
    • SQLite
  • Data Persistence - 2

    • Core Data
    • NS User Defaults
  • Concurrency and Background Execution

    • GCD and Closures
    • NS Operation and NS Operation Queue
    • Background execution
  • Networking, Connectivity

  • Multimedia

Download Syllabus - iOS
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

iOS Jobs in Vijayawada

Enjoy the demand

Find jobs related to iOS in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Vijayawada, chennai and europe countries. You can find many jobs for freshers related to the job positions in Vijayawada.

  • iOS Developer
  • Mobile iOS Developer
  • IOS App Developer
  • iOS Developer Flutter
  • Mobile Security Engineer
  • iOS Engineer
  • Native iOS Developer
  • Sr. Mobile iOS Developer
  • Software Engineer (iOS)
  • Lead Developer iOS

iOS Internship/Course Details

iOS internship jobs in Vijayawada
iOS Start-ups and small enterprises looking for a quick return on their investment can explore iOS Application Development. After the program, our participants will be eligible to take any type of interview. Because of the unique features and support it provides to its clients, Apple iOS has maintained its dominance in the smartphone sector. We provide hands-on iOS App Development classes in a variety of {locations}. Our instructor has over ten years of experience working in MNCs in the fields of iOS App Development and related technologies. Nestsoft offers the best iOS App Development training on-site with the most knowledgeable instructors. . Before you finish the course, we will provide you with real-practice time and help you design your iOS app. Most developers these days don't have much expertise with iOS development, thus you'll be able to find work at reputable companies. The design of iOS is based on the UNIX and Mac OS operating systems, and it allows for direct interaction such as touch, swipes, and other gestures.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Basil

Mobile: +91 8301010866
Location: Kerala, Online (Vijayawada)
Qualification: B.Tech

Experience: Python developer with expertise in Django skilled in web development backend programming and database management |   more..

Akshaya

Mobile: +91 89210 61945
Location: Calicut , Online (Vijayawada)
Qualification: be.computer science

Experience: Full stack developer intern at babbtra cyber square professional software training institute Application for Python Django  more..

Chikati

Mobile: +91 91884 77559
Location: Telangana, Online (Vijayawada)
Qualification: Computer science and engineering

Experience: I am good with cyber security and penetration testing and python programming   more..

Prakhar

Mobile: +91 9446600368
Location: Jaipur, Online (Vijayawada)
Qualification: PhD

Experience: AI ML developer NGS data analyst Journal Reviewer | Resume for   more..

Ratika

Mobile: +91 89210 61945
Location: Maharashtra, Online (Vijayawada)
Qualification: B.Tech

Experience: Jira Test Rail Active Directory SQL Functional and non functional testing regression Testing selenium  more..

Sony

Mobile: +91 91884 77559
Location: Kerala, Online (Vijayawada)
Qualification: MCA, PG DIPLOMA IN MONTESSORI TTC

Experience: I have 2 years of teaching experience in computer science and physics subjects at TEAM INTREVEL I acquired skills are  more..

Renupriya

Mobile: +91 98474 90866
Location: Kerala, Online (Vijayawada)
Qualification: Msc Computer Science

Experience: I am a highly motivated software engineer with a recent M Sc in Computer Science I possess strong skills in  more..

Mehak

Mobile: +91 9446600368
Location: Delhi, Online (Vijayawada)
Qualification: graduate

Experience: I am writing to express my enthusiasm for the graphic designer position As a recent graduate I am excited to  more..

Vaishna

Mobile: +91 9895490866
Location: Kerala, Online (Vijayawada)
Qualification: Btech

Experience: Excel work data entry programming skills  more..

Chandni

Mobile: +91 91884 77559
Location: Indore, Online (Vijayawada)
Qualification: B.tech

Experience: I have certified knowledge of React js html css c c++ programming languages And I have 6 months experience of  more..

DEVI

Mobile: +91 91884 77559
Location: Kerala, Online (Vijayawada)
Qualification: M Tech

Experience: Linear algebra calculus mathematics logical and reasoning skills python  more..

AKHIL

Mobile: +91 91884 77559
Location: Kerala, Online (Vijayawada)
Qualification: SSLC, PLUSTWO, DIPLOMA IN GWD, FSWD

Experience: Counter Staff Cashierin Ariesplex SlCinemas TVM Kerala : 2 5years Sales Assistant in Big Bazaar TVM Kerala :1year Sales man  more..

Krishnendu

Mobile: +91 98474 90866
Location: Kerala, Online (Vijayawada)
Qualification: Graduate

Experience: Adobe creative suite Graphic design UI design  more..

ankit

Mobile: +91 9446600368
Location: Madhya Pradesh, Online (Vijayawada)
Qualification: B.tech computer science and engineering

Experience: Hello sir ma'am my name is Ankit Lodhi and I am currently working in a zucol service as a python  more..

Shadab

Mobile: +91 91884 77559
Location: Maharashtra, Online (Vijayawada)
Qualification: B.tech

Experience: I completed full stack Dot net developer course from naresh IT Hyderabad  more..

Boomika

Mobile: +91 89210 61945
Location: Chennai , Online (Vijayawada)
Qualification: BE - computer science and engineering

Experience: Python (Basic and advanced) oops GUI SQl basic of HTML and c programming Application for Python Django  more..

somasekhar

Mobile: +91 91884 77559
Location: banagalore, Online (Vijayawada)
Qualification: bsc computers

Experience: python django pandas numpy | Resume for   more..

Shubhangi

Mobile: +91 91884 77559
Location: Faridabad, Online (Vijayawada)
Qualification: B.tech

Experience: Vb 6 0 html html5 ccna c c++   more..

Dhanesh

Mobile: +91 91884 77559
Location: Kerala, Online (Vijayawada)
Qualification: Btech

Experience: Plc programming scada programming it software handling high learning skills  more..

Mithila

Mobile: +91 9895490866
Location: Coimbatore, Online (Vijayawada)
Qualification: B.E (ECE)

Experience: Basic C C++ HTML python As a fresher I don't have a work experience but opportunity once come I'll give  more..

GANESH

Mobile: +91 91884 77559
Location: Telangana, Online (Vijayawada)
Qualification: MSc BED

Experience: Thanks for visiting my Profile ! I am a passionate and dedicated educator wih my 5 years experience in teaching  more..

Lakshman

Mobile: +91 98474 90866
Location: Andhra Pradesh, Online (Vijayawada)
Qualification: MBA

Experience: Good knowledge of MS office Tally ERP-9 and oracle ERP My experience 2 months in teaching and 2 months in  more..

Anand

Mobile: +91 89210 61945
Location: Kerala, Online (Vijayawada)
Qualification: BCA

Experience: I have one year experience in manual testing |   more..

M

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Vijayawada)
Qualification: Mca

Experience: Concealing in team members and sale the project administration and development team working with team   more..

RUSAINA

Mobile: +91 89210 61945
Location: Ernakulam, Online (Vijayawada)
Qualification: Bachelors Degree

Experience: Marketing strategy planning Market research Social media management content planning & designing website architecture checks Word press development video editing  more..

SWAYAMPU

Mobile: +91 89210 61945
Location: Prakasam District, Online (Vijayawada)
Qualification: Btech

Experience: Manual testing and automation testing (selenium java) | Resume for   more..

RAJAN

Mobile: +91 8301010866
Location: Haryana, Online (Vijayawada)
Qualification: BTech

Experience: Flutter and Dart angular ionic react native  more..

Dheeraj

Mobile: +91 9446600368
Location: Haryana, Online (Vijayawada)
Qualification: B.Tech in ECE

Experience: 2 year experience in Manual software testing |   more..

varsha

Mobile: +91 91884 77559
Location: ernakulam, Online (Vijayawada)
Qualification: mca

Experience: selenium jira jmeter mantis manual testing mobile app testing sql html  more..

Shivani

Mobile: +91 9446600368
Location: Pune, Online (Vijayawada)
Qualification: Graduation

Experience: I am writing this letter to express my interest for the post of Software test engineer I with "Eduvanz Financing  more..

Saurabh

Mobile: +91 91884 77559
Location: Maharashtra, Online (Vijayawada)
Qualification: B.com

Experience: I posses required skills and done the certification course from one of the reputed company and I know Manual testing  more..

Darshini

Mobile: +91 9446600368
Location: Rajkot Gujarat , Online (Vijayawada)
Qualification: BCA

Experience: Hello this is darshini kanpara I have completed my graduation in BCA and I am fresher I am interested in  more..

Shubhangi

Mobile: +91 98474 90866
Location: Maharashtra, Online (Vijayawada)
Qualification: MSc computer science

Experience: Manual testing Smoke testing Sanity testing Regression testing  more..

Ricky

Mobile: +91 9446600368
Location: Kerala, Online (Vijayawada)
Qualification: Bachelor's in Electrical and Electronics Engineering

Experience: With nearly 1 8 years of experience in manual testing I specialize in commodity trading and risk management platforms My  more..

Naveen

Mobile: +91 9446600368
Location: Rajasthan, Online (Vijayawada)
Qualification: Bachelors in technology

Experience: Equiped with the skills like power point online teaching geography content development and social studies and having a total working  more..

Devyani

Mobile: +91 9446600368
Location: Maharashtra, Online (Vijayawada)
Qualification: PGDM and BTECH (computer science)

Experience: Content writing research seo graphic designing using canva market research competitive analysis  more..

Kiran

Mobile: +91 89210 61945
Location: Maharashtra, Online (Vijayawada)
Qualification: Bachelor of engineering in electronics and telecommunication

Experience: As a seasoned Software Manual Testing Engineer with two years of hands-on experience my objective is to contribute my skills  more..

Ethakula

Mobile: +91 89210 61945
Location: Andhra Pradesh, Online (Vijayawada)
Qualification: Bcom CA

Experience: The professional journey of the individual spans various educational and training domains Beginning at Focus Edumatics from 2022 to 2023  more..

Sadika

Mobile: +91 9895490866
Location: Uttar Pradesh, Online (Vijayawada)
Qualification: Graduation

Experience: MS Excel MS word content writing web development   more..

Mayuri

Mobile: +91 98474 90866
Location: Maharashtra, Online (Vijayawada)
Qualification: MCA

Experience: I have experience in manual testing and automation testing i have good knowledge MySQL java html css selenium API testing  more..

Tarun

Mobile: +91 98474 90866
Location: Karnataka, Online (Vijayawada)
Qualification: Final year undergraduate pursuing BE in Computer Science

Experience: programming languages: C C++ Python Java Frontend development: HTML CSS JavaScript Bootstrap ReactJs  more..

Vivek

Mobile: +91 9446600368
Location: Ahmedabad, Online (Vijayawada)
Qualification: MscIT

Experience: I have 2+ year of experience of full time flutter developer Thank you   more..

Sohail

Mobile: +91 91884 77559
Location: Jharkhand, Online (Vijayawada)
Qualification: BCA

Experience: Linux shell scripting MySQL php javascript html CSS  more..

jisha

Mobile: +91 9446600368
Location: thrissur, Online (Vijayawada)
Qualification: msc electronics

Experience: python django frame work html cssApplication for Python Django  more..

Abhishek

Mobile: +91 9895490866
Location: Mandsaur, Online (Vijayawada)
Qualification: BTech

Experience: python data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

Preeti

Mobile: +91 8301010866
Location: Maharashtra, Online (Vijayawada)
Qualification: M.Sc. Textile & Clothing

Experience: My 8 years teaching experience fashion design CAD Design all software Adobe Photoshop Adobe Illustrator Adobe InDesign Coral Draw  more..

Shabnam

Mobile: +91 91884 77559
Location: Mumbai, Online (Vijayawada)
Qualification: MCA

Experience: 12 years of training experience python data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ial  more..

Nirmala

Mobile: +91 9895490866
Location: Gujarat, Online (Vijayawada)
Qualification: Mca

Experience: I have total experience 3 4 years I have created 6 application in flutter I have good experience in flutter  more..

kavishwar

Mobile: +91 9895490866
Location: Maharashtra, Online (Vijayawada)
Qualification: BFA

Experience: I'm graphic designer I have completed my bachelor degree in marthwada university aurangabad I have 8 years experience in graphic  more..

Nutan

Mobile: +91 9446600368
Location: Pune, Online (Vijayawada)
Qualification: B. E

Experience: I am graduate in E C stream Having certification in Manual testing And also having around 2 years of experience  more..

Shubhra

Mobile: +91 91884 77559
Location: Mumbai, Online (Vijayawada)
Qualification: Bsc Computer Science

Experience: I have done software testing manual and automation testing Experience is fresher Good command on writing defect reports with 3  more..

Ibrhaim

Mobile: +91 91884 77559
Location: Kerala, Online (Vijayawada)
Qualification: Degree in BCA

Experience: MEARN Fullstack development React MongoDB Express js Angular Node js HTML CSS JavaScript  more..

Ansuman

Mobile: +91 98474 90866
Location: Karnataka, Online (Vijayawada)
Qualification: b.tec

Experience: 1 year of experience in mvvm android studios api integration git hub   more..

Sachin

Mobile: +91 8301010866
Location: Haryana, Online (Vijayawada)
Qualification: BCA

Experience: Software development Php Python C  more..

Veerendra

Mobile: +91 8301010866
Location: Andhra Pradesh, Online (Vijayawada)
Qualification: BTech

Experience: Manual testing (test case creation execution bug reporting) Debugging Test management tools Api testing  more..

Kanchi

Mobile: +91 89210 61945
Location: Uttar Pradesh, Online (Vijayawada)
Qualification: BTech

Experience: I like to do painting draw sketches and loving to do design a jwellery and dresses  more..

Minu

Mobile: +91 98474 90866
Location: Chennai, Online (Vijayawada)
Qualification: B.Sc electronics and communication science

Experience: Fresher manual testing selenium testng automation testing software testing Java SQL  more..

Saikrishna

Mobile: +91 91884 77559
Location: Telangana, Online (Vijayawada)
Qualification: BTech (CSE)

Experience: I have experience in flutter development in Android and iOS apps  more..

Gayatri

Mobile: +91 98474 90866
Location: Odisha, Online (Vijayawada)
Qualification: Btech

Experience: Administration Software Development Software testing  more..

Aditya

Mobile: +91 9895490866
Location: Jharkhand, Online (Vijayawada)
Qualification: Bachelor

Experience: Efficient Programming problem solving network penetration testing etc That above resume is made quickly I aquires more qualifications and a  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in vijayawada
Internship/projects in vijayawada
Internship/projects in vijayawada
Internship/projects in vijayawada
Internship/projects in vijayawada
Internship/projects in vijayawada
Internship/projects in vijayawada
Internship/projects in vijayawada
Internship/projects in vijayawada
Internship/projects in vijayawada
Internship/projects in vijayawada
Internship/projects in vijayawada

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er